"Paternity Leave" in California - A Primer for New Dads
WebPaternity leave is time off for parenting granted to. a new biological father, a male partner of a pregnant woman, a surrogate father, or; an adoptive father. California and federal law grant new fathers up to 12 weeks of unpaid paternity leave to bond with a newborn, a newly adopted child, or a new foster child. WebDec 29, 2024 · Under the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A), many new fathers have the ability to take leave from work to care for a newborn, adopted, or injured child. Yet less than 22 percent do so, perhaps out of ignorance of their fathers' rights and the FMLA. The FMLA allows eligible employees to take 12 weeks of unpaid leave when a child is born ...
